怎么查看当前redis配置
-
要查看当前 Redis 的配置,可以通过以下几种方法:
-
使用 Redis 命令行界面(CLI):
- 打开终端或命令提示符窗口,输入
redis-cli进入 Redis 命令行界面。 - 输入
CONFIG GET *命令,即可获取到 Redis 的所有配置信息。
- 打开终端或命令提示符窗口,输入
-
使用 Redis 的 INFO 命令:
- 同样在 Redis 命令行界面中,输入
INFO命令。 - 该命令将返回一系列关于 Redis 的统计信息和设置。
- 同样在 Redis 命令行界面中,输入
-
查看 Redis 配置文件:
- Redis 的配置文件通常位于
/etc/redis/redis.conf或/etc/redis.conf,具体位置取决于你的操作系统和 Redis 的安装方式。 - 打开配置文件,可以使用文本编辑器或命令行工具,查找和浏览其中的配置项。
- Redis 的配置文件通常位于
-
使用 Redis 服务器的 CONFIG GET 命令:
- 在 Redis 命令行界面或可以发送 Redis 命令的客户端中,发送
CONFIG GET <config-name>命令。 - 替换
<config-name>为具体的配置项名称,比如maxmemory,port等。 - 通过该命令可以获取指定配置项的值。
- 在 Redis 命令行界面或可以发送 Redis 命令的客户端中,发送
以上是几种常用的查看 Redis 配置的方法,根据你的实际需求和使用场景,选择合适的方法进行查看。
1年前 -
-
要查看当前Redis配置,你可以使用以下方法:
-
使用Redis命令行界面:打开终端并输入
redis-cli,然后连接到Redis服务器。输入CONFIG GET *命令,将返回所有配置项及其对应的值。你也可以使用CONFIG GET <key>命令只获取特定配置项的值,例如CONFIG GET port获取端口配置的值。 -
使用Redis配置文件:Redis的配置文件是redis.conf,默认情况下位于Redis安装目录的根目录。你可以使用任何文本编辑器打开该文件,并浏览其中的配置项。查找与你关心的配置项相关的行,并查看其对应的值。例如,你可以找到
port 6379行来查看Redis的端口配置。 -
使用Redis的INFO命令:在Redis命令行界面输入
INFO命令,将返回关于Redis的各种信息,包括配置信息。该命令将返回一个包含各个部分和配置项的信息块。你可以使用INFO <section>命令只获取特定部分的信息,例如INFO server获取与服务器相关的配置信息。 -
使用Redis的CONFIG命令:在Redis命令行界面输入
CONFIG GET <key>命令,其中<key>是你要查看的配置项的键名。例如,要查看maxclients配置的值,你可以输入CONFIG GET maxclients。 -
使用第三方工具:Redis提供了一些第三方工具,可以帮助你更方便地查看和管理配置。例如,Redis Desktop Manager是一个跨平台的GUI工具,它提供了一个图形化界面以查看和编辑Redis的配置。你可以下载并安装这些工具,然后使用它们查看Redis的配置。
1年前 -
-
查看当前Redis配置可以通过以下几种方法:
-
使用Redis命令行客户端查看配置:
首先,打开命令行终端,然后输入redis-cli命令来启动Redis命令行客户端。连接到Redis服务器后,可以使用以下命令来查看配置:
CONFIG GET * // 查看所有的配置项 CONFIG GET <parameter> // 查看指定参数的配置,例如:CONFIG GET maxmemory例如,如果要查看Redis的最大内存限制(maxmemory)配置,可以使用以下命令:
> CONFIG GET maxmemoryRedis将返回配置的值,例如:
1) "maxmemory" 2) "104857600" // 返回的值表示最大内存限制为104857600字节(100MB) -
通过Redis配置文件查看配置:
Redis的配置文件通常被命名为
redis.conf,可以通过查看该文件来获取Redis的当前配置。首先,找到Redis的配置文件所在的位置。通常情况下,Redis的配置文件位于安装目录中的
etc文件夹中,文件名为redis.conf或redis.conf.sample。打开该配置文件,可以通过搜索关键字的方式找到特定的配置项。例如,查找最大内存限制(maxmemory)配置,可以搜索关键字
maxmemory。# Redis最大内存限制 # maxmemory <bytes> # # 对于字符串数据类型,当达到最大内存限制时,可配置Redis策略如何处理。 # ... maxmemory 104857600 // 最大内存限制为104857600字节(100MB)配置文件中的配置项通常有注释来解释每个选项的作用。
-
使用Redis INFO命令查看配置:
另一种查看Redis配置的方法是使用Redis的INFO命令。
在Redis命令行客户端中输入以下命令:
INFORedis将返回Redis服务器的信息,其中包含有关配置的信息。
可以使用grep命令(对于Linux/MacOS)或find命令(对于Windows)来过滤感兴趣的配置信息。例如,要查找最大内存限制(maxmemory)配置,可以使用以下命令:
> INFO | grep maxmemoryRedis将返回与最大内存限制相关的信息,例如:
maxmemory:104857600 // 最大内存限制为104857600字节(100MB)以上就是查看当前Redis配置的几种方法。根据需要选择适合的方法来查看Redis的配置信息。
1年前 -